Transaction 81ddcc3869aa916ebcf1464f9588c4ad767a62f2b3e680433b777f9e6631e162
1 Input
1 Output
-
81ddcc3869aa916ebcf1464f9588c4ad767a62f2b3e680433b777f9e6631e162:0
- value
- 5442
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9a709ff3b44dec45bc9f56b34d3f41d84c04da48ffd732665791d01d6472e11b
- address
- bc1pnfcflua5fhkyt0yl26e5606pmpxqfkjglltnyejhj8gp6erjuydsp0psun